Tracert或Traceroute是网络诊断的关键之一。那么,它是如何工作的,如何运行它呢?
Tracert或Traceroute是网络和特定网络数据包的关键要素之一。该命令允许专家了解网络的完整性及其运行速度。
但是,理解Tracert命令需要了解它们的根源及其起源。因此,让我们深入讨论一下traceroute命令,它是什么,它如何工作,以及如何运行它。
路径跟踪程序是什么?
Tracert是一系列的计算机的命令帮助用户查找网络诊断和报告。它用于显示网络数据包的路径,这些数据包将数据从一端传输到另一端。换句话说,它是一个跟踪器命令,允许您检查数据转换的可能显示路由。
这个过程需要计算机将数据发送到另一台计算机,并等待它返回。一旦它做到了,它就会衡量网络传输这些数据的速度和能力。因此,这是Windows下的一个计算机网络诊断命令。
在每个微软操作系统的语法中,这个过程允许用户检查来自另一台计算机的ping接收时间。Windows上Tracert命令的重点是来回跟踪路由,这将产生更清晰的结果。
但是,在基于Windows nt的计算机中,同样的操作被调用PathPing,因为它允许您检查特定的ping路径,并通过发送和接收的数据包测量其速度。但是,首选的方法仍然是使用Tracert命令。
什么是路由跟踪
Traceroute与Tracert命令相同,不同之处在于类unix操作系统,即macOS和Linux,即Ubuntu等。与Windows相比,Traceroute在macOS中作为图形界面可用,您可以在Network Utilities Suite中找到它。
然而,在Linux中,它仍然是一个命令行工具,需要您键入命令来跟踪网络路由并沿线路发送数据包。因此,它是Unix操作系统版本的Tracert,允许彻底的网络诊断。
在Mac和Linux中,该命令行的工作方式有很大的不同,因为它要求您理解相应的诊断,这一点我们将在稍后讨论。然而,了解Traceroute和Tracert的基本原理是相同的是很重要的。
因此,它们的目的也是如此,它允许用户完全扫描其本地网络的问题,并通过隔离特定数据包或网络链来识别问题。
如何使用Tracert/Traceroute?
使用Tracert或Traceroute,或理解如何在每个操作系统上使用它,要求我们彻底了解每个方面。因此,我们必须根据它们的操作系统来分解Tracert命令。
- 窗户
- Mac
- Linux
由于Linux是最复杂的操作系统,我们建议只有熟悉该操作系统的用户才能尝试它。对于Mac来说,运行这个诊断程序可能是最简单的。而对于Windows,您需要足够的命令提示符知识才能使用Tracert。
让我们开始吧:
如何在Windows系统下执行Tracert命令?
我们将研究的第一种方法是在Windows操作系统上运行Tracert命令。这对于Windows 7之后的所有操作系统都是可行的,应该允许您检查相应的诊断。因此,以下是你需要做的:
第一步:前往开始菜单或按下窗口按钮在你的键盘
步骤2:类型CMD而且以管理员身份运行
第三步:让它打开命令提示符
步骤4:类型路径跟踪程序的主机名(您应该输入您希望诊断的服务器地址,而不是“主机名”)
步骤5:让测试运行,这应该需要大约一到两分钟
第六步:等待跟踪完成显示
现在你有了数据,你必须继续滚动才能阅读它。但是,如果您已经知道如何阅读它,那么您就知道每个MS表示什么。
测试结果表示毫秒,即网络来回发送数据包所花费的时间。因此,请确保根据不同的操作系统遵循不同的Tracert命令的读取类型。
如何在Mac上运行Traceroute ?
在Mac设备上运行Traceroute是所有方法中最简单的。这就是为什么你只需要有一台Mac电脑,并知道如何使用你的设备的“实用程序”部分。虽然第一个很明显,下面是如何使用第二个在Mac上运行Traceroute:
步骤1:进入仪在你的Mac设备上
第二步:点击去在Finder的顶部栏中
第三步:找到并点击公用事业公司在表明
第四步:头部终端
第五步:类型traceroute在终端
第六步:等待它完成
您可能已经知道,可以通过多种方式访问Finder应用程序中的Utilities。但是,无论你如何到达那里,你都需要运行终端,这是Mac上的命令提示符。因此,请确保运行这些命令来实现这一点。
如何在Linux机器上运行Traceroute ?
Linux用户可能已经知道如何运行Traceroute,因为即使将Linux作为普通操作系统运行,也需要他们记住大量命令。然而,如果你是新手,还在寻找,那么你需要做的是:
步骤1:打开命令行在你的Linux操作系统中
步骤2:类型Traceroute主机名在命令行中(用实际的主机名替换主机名)
步骤3:等待测试完成
步骤4:让最后的ping检测
您必须自己确定主机名,但是为了测试本地网络,您可以检查任何网站,就像我们在前面的步骤中检查谷歌一样。但是,如果您希望检查特定的IP地址,则必须更加精确。
无论如何,您需要命令行、Traceroute命令和服务器IP/网站才能在Linux中跟踪网络的路由。
如何读取Tracert/Traceroute查询结果?
阅读或理解Tracert或Traceroute的结果并不是火箭科学。假设您已经了解了本文的内容。在这种情况下,您知道终端、命令提示符或命令行生成的数字不是随机的。
他们在阅读各种元素。所以,为了简单起见,记住这个:
- 如果有一个或多个星号(*)
- RTT或Round Trip Time显示延迟,即一个包的延迟。在CMD或Linux命令行中,它显示为MS或毫秒
- 名称,即系统的名称,以及您正在使用的计算机
- IP地址是指定主机名返回的IP地址
- RTO或请求超时意味着服务器的ping中断,连接不稳定
虽然有些连接的响应显示为MS,但如果是1000+ MS,则表示连接非常缓慢和不稳定。然而,请求超时意味着连接没有发回任何东西,因此是断开的。
底线
我们希望这有助于您阅读和理解Tracert和Traceroute命令。我们不仅探索了它的两种类型,还研究了如何在三种主要操作系统上检查它们。因此,请确保您正确地执行了这些步骤。
这个页面有用吗?
相关文章
特蕾西王/ 2022-08-25
戴夫/ 2022-08-25
亚伦保罗/ 2022-08-24
大卫Balaban / 2022-06-02